painstaking
美 [?pe?nz?te?k??]
英 ['pe?nz.te?k??] 
- adj.需細(xì)心的;辛苦的;需專注的
- n.苦干
- 網(wǎng)絡(luò)苦干的;費(fèi)力的;煞費(fèi)苦心的
反義詞
同義詞
英漢雙解
1. | 需細(xì)心的;辛苦的;需專注的needing a lot of care, effort and attention to detail |
| painstaking research 細(xì)心的研究 |
| The event had been planned with painstaking attention to detail. 這次活動(dòng)的細(xì)節(jié)是經(jīng)過精心計(jì)劃的。 |
